What does "automated and policy-based" mean, and why can NetworkManager not fill this role? NetworkManager is completely controllable by the D-Bus interface and by the network settings. You can manually control it by setting all connections to 'autoconnect=no' and telling NM explicitly which ones to activate via D-Bus.
"Also remember in many embedded devices user control/display of network settings is simply not done, or not allowed by policy."
Why is this relevant? NetworkManager does *NOT* require a UI to operate. It is completely controllable via D-Bus, like ConnMan.
There's nothing stopping NetworkManager from being used on netbooks and MIDs. It's already being used there. There's nothing to stop it from being used on embedded devices too, except FUD.
